Let the equation of the line pass through (x₁, y₁) and (x₂, y₂). Then the equation of the line is given as,
The table represents some points on the graph of a linear function.
х у
-7.5 12
-3.5 0
-1 -7.5
2 -16.5
3.5 -21
Take two points from the table, then the points are (-7.5, 12) and (-3.5, 0). Then the equation of the line is given as,
y - 0 = [(-3.5 + 7.5) / (0 - 12)](x + 3.5)
y = - (1/3)(x + 3.5)
3y = - x - 3.5
x + 3y + 3.5 = 0
The function represents the same relationship between x and y will be x + 3y + 3.5 = 0.
